What Is Meditation and Spiritual Exercises Therapy?

This therapy combines clinically informed techniques with ancient wisdom to support emotional regulation, stress reduction, and personal growth. The goal is to create space for healing by calming the nervous system, encouraging self-reflection, and helping you reconnect with your authentic self. Our sessions often include a combination of:

  • Guided Meditation
  • Breathwork and Conscious Breathing Techniques
  • Mindfulness Training
  • Body Awareness and Grounding Exercises
  • Spiritual Reflection Practices

Benefits of This Therapy

People from all walks of life can benefit from meditation and spiritual exercises. You don’t need to follow a specific religion or have prior experience with mindfulness practices. Benefits may include:

  • Reduced anxiety, stress, and emotional tension
  • Improved focus and mental clarity
  • Enhanced sleep quality
  • Increased self-awareness and emotional intelligence
  • A deeper sense of purpose and personal alignment

Commonly Asked Questions

Do I need to be religious to benefit from spiritual exercises therapy?
No, not at all. This therapy is open to individuals of all faith backgrounds or none. It’s about connecting with your inner self, finding balance, and cultivating peace, whatever that looks like for you.
What can I expect during a session?
A typical session may involve guided meditation, breathwork, or reflective discussion. You’ll be encouraged to slow down, center yourself, and explore your thoughts or emotions in a calm, structured space.
How is this different from regular meditation classes?
While meditation classes often focus on techniques alone, our therapy integrates emotional support, personalized guidance, and spiritual exploration led by licensed professionals. It’s therapeutic, not just instructional.
Can this therapy be combined with other treatments?
Yes. Many clients combine meditation and spiritual exercises with other therapies such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) or trauma counseling. It enhances your overall mental health plan.
How long before I notice results?
Many clients report feeling more relaxed and centered after just one session. Long-term benefits such as emotional resilience and greater self-awareness, develop over time with consistent practice.
